+Overall read: this component is a hand-built confirm/cancel dialog — full-screen fixed backdrop,
+centered panel, Escape-to-close, click-outside-to-close, Confirm/Cancel buttons — which is close
+to a line-for-line description of what `@codecademy/gamut`'s `Modal`/`Dialog` already provides,
+including the accessible dialog semantics, focus trap, and backdrop dismiss conventions that this
+file reimplements without a focus trap at all (no focus management/restoration visible). Worth a
+manual comparison against `Modal`/`Dialog` before treating this as a deliberate one-off. See
+gamut-modal skill for the props/usage pattern to migrate to.
